      <description>&lt;P&gt;So on a part I'm designing for a home project, I create a hole of 8.5mm diameter 45mm long, I then create an M10 thread within that hole 11mm long, this 3d prints without issue when exported. However when I create a drawing from this model and use the hole and thread notes, no matter the view angle, instead of M10x1.5 11mm I get 8.5 x 45 and 10.5 x 90 degrees&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I've redone the hole and thread modelling in case I've made a mistake, recreated the drawing and it still does it.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Can someone please explain where I'm going wrong on this...already had to apologise to someone I sent the drawing to as I didn't notice this issue at first.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Frustrated does not cover this....&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;You only get callouts if you use the hole tool to create the hole and thread in one feature. It will not work if you add a thread to an existing hole using a thread feature.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Edit. You need to create all the features in one hole feature like this.&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;P&gt;I think it's the way it is at the moment because it's easy and was quick to implement, just read the info from the hole feature. Gets a bit more complicated if you have to read holes created from extrudes, revolves and maybe a chamfer then a thread. Hopefully they'll improve the way it works, you can't even use a callout for male threads at the moment.&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;P&gt;Don't forget you can just right click a hole on the model and select modify feature to add threads or make other changes, probably quicker than adding threads later.&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;P&gt;I thought I'd reply to your message, regarding the hole &amp;amp; thread notes tool. Wherever possible, I like to be open about what we're working on and what's next with regard to drawings tools.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;In October 2020 we launched the 1st iteration of thread notes, this is what is currently in the product. The 1st iteration recognises hole features and creates annotations from the information in the model, formatted to either the ISO or ASME standard.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Our &lt;A href="https://app.mural.co/t/autodesk2145/m/timerahart2/1475171276107/0945259b7c22117012173ea2be3c9151fec1f184?sender=u0f22cc94bfd44428866e6019" target="_blank" rel="noopener"&gt;public roadmap&lt;/A&gt; shows our 2nd iteration, a project called "Improve Hole &amp;amp; thread Notes (Include external Threads)" - Under "Annotations".&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;This 2nd iteration, is currently in progress. Once we complete the 2nd iteration of this project, the tool will have expanded capabilities which will include the ability to annotate threads added to circular (no hole) extrudes, as well as external threads. Keep an eye on the roadmap and the &lt;A href="https://www.autodesk.com/products/fusion-360/blog/category/whatsnew/" target="_blank"&gt;&lt;SPAN style="font-weight: 400;"&gt;What’s new blog posts&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/A&gt;&lt;SPAN style="font-weight: 400;"&gt;.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P data-unlink="true"&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P data-unlink="true"&gt;When building new tools, we often take an evolutionary approach, which allows us to give users access to key functionality sooner, while we build the next phase(s). This Agile approach allows us to gather additional user feedback between iterations, allowing for continual improvement. A recent example of this approach, is the work we did with Break/Broken views.&lt;/P&gt;
